The Best Sports Bars for Every Team
1. STATS Sports Bar & Grill - Located in the heart of Midtown Atlanta, this sports bar is a favorite among locals and visitors alike. With over 40 TVs showing live games, you'll never miss a play. STATS offers an impressive selection of craft beers and classic pub fare, including their signature wings. Don't miss the chance to catch a Braves game on one of their many screens.
2. Fadó Irish Pub - This lively Irish pub in Buckhead is a must-visit for any sports fan. With an impressive selection of whiskeys and beers, you'll feel like you're in the midst of a championship game. Fadó's has been named one of Atlanta's best sports bars by numerous publications, and it's easy to see why.
3. Game On! - Located in Little Five Points, this sports bar is a local favorite among Atlantans. With over 20 TVs showing live games, you'll never miss a moment of the action. Game On!'s menu features classic pub fare with a twist, including their famous "Mac Daddy" burger.
